3,018 (three thousand eighteen) is an even 4-digit number. It is a composite number with 8 divisors, and factors as 2 × 3 × 503. Its proper divisors sum to 3,030, more than the number itself, making it an abundant number. Written other ways, in Roman numerals it is MMMXVIII and in binary, 101111001010.

Goldbach decomposition

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 3018, here are decompositions:

  • 7 + 3011 = 3018
  • 17 + 3001 = 3018
  • 19 + 2999 = 3018
  • 47 + 2971 = 3018
  • 61 + 2957 = 3018
  • 79 + 2939 = 3018
  • 101 + 2917 = 3018
  • 109 + 2909 = 3018

Showing the first eight; more decompositions exist.
